Default Tire pressure for a 2008 Conquest Super C

Hello,



Less than a year into RVing. We have a 2008 conquest super C. I did purchase a TM system late last season which I like. My door frame says inflate to 95psi cold, but the tires say 110 psi cold. Any recommendations? Thanks in advance!

DOOR JAMB LABEL is 95 RECOMMENDED whereas the tire sidewall is MAXIMUM COLD pressure. You will RIDE MUCH better at the Dor Jamb pressure

Sounds like the original tire was a 12ply, load range F tire. That would account for the 95psi rating on the door jam. Mine came with those as well. Looks like the previous owner upgraded to a 14ply G rated tire, which has a 110psi rating.
